Frequently Asked Questions

What is the median home value in Hitchcock County?
The median home value in Hitchcock County is $88,800. This is below the national median of $281,900.
How much is rent in Hitchcock County?
The median gross rent in Hitchcock County is $715 per month.
What is the property tax rate in Hitchcock County?
The effective property tax rate in Hitchcock County is 1.24%. The median annual property tax bill is $1,105.
Is Hitchcock County affordable?
With a home-value-to-income ratio of 1.7x, Hitchcock County is considered affordable compared to the recommended 3-4x guideline.
